skip to main content
10.1145/3410566.3410605acmotherconferencesArticle/Chapter ViewAbstractPublication PagesideasConference Proceedingsconference-collections
research-article

Bridging the gap between business processes and IoT

Published: 25 August 2020 Publication History

Abstract

This paper discusses a novel way of making business processes and Internet of Things (IoT) work together. Indeed each "suffers" from many limitations that the other could help address them and vice versa. On the one hand, business processes are known for capturing organizations' best practices when satisfying users' demands but do not have the capabilities of controlling the physical surrounding that comprises millions of devices/things. On the other hand, IoT is known for provisioning contextualized services to users thanks to millions of devices/things but does not have the capabilities of making these devices/things collaborate. The paper presents a framework to support the collaboration of business processes and IoT. This collaboration is exemplified with 2 types of processes referred as thing-aware processes (TaP) and process-of-things (PoT). A system illustrating the development of PoT is presented in the paper as well.

References

[1]
D. Andročec, B. Tomaš, and T. Kišasondi. Interoperability and Lightweight Security for Simple IoT Devices. In Proceedings of the Information Systems Security Conference (ISS'2017) held in conjunction with the 40th Jubilee International Convention on Information and Communication Technology, Electronics, and Microelectronics (MIPRO'2017), Opatija, Croatia, May 2017.
[2]
A. Bröring, A. Ziller, V. Charpenay, S. Schmid, A. Thuluva, D. Anicic, A. Zappa, M. Linares, L. Mikkelsen, and C. Seidel. The BIG IoT API - Semantically Enabling IoT Interoperability. IEEE Pervasive Computing, August 2018 (forthcoming).
[3]
N. Brouns, S. Tata, H. Ludwig, E. Asensio, and P. Grefen. Modeling IoT-aware Business Processes: A State of the Art Report. Technical Report IBM Research Report RJ10540, 2018.
[4]
Y. Cheng, S. Zhao, B. Cheng, and J. Chen. A Resource Oriented Modeling Approach for the Internet of Things: A Business Process Perspective. In Proceedings of MODELS'2017 Satellite Event held in conjunction with ACM/IEEE 20th International Conference on Model Driven Engineering Languages and Systems (MODELS'2017), Austin, TX, USA, 2017.
[5]
S. Cherrier and V. Deshpande. From BPM to IoT. In Business Process Management Workshops held in conjunction with BPM'2017, Barcelona, Spain, 2017.
[6]
M. Dastani, L. van der Torre, and N. Yorke-Smith. Agent-Oriented Cooperative Smart Objects: From IoT System Design to Implementation. IEEE Transactions on Systems, Man, and Cybernetics: Systems, (Fortino, G. and Russo, W. and Savaglio, C. and Shen, W. and Zhou, M.), 2017 (forthcoming).
[7]
D. Domingos and F. Martins. Using BPMN to Model Internet of Things Behavior within Business Process. International Journal of Information Systems and Project Management, 5(4), 2017.
[8]
DZone. The Internet of Things, Application, Protocls, and Best Practices. Technical report, https://dzone.com/guides/iot-applications-protocols-and-best-practices, 2017 (visited in May 2017).
[9]
C. Friedow, M. Völker, and M. Hewelt. Integrating IoT Devices into Business Processes. In Proceedings of the 1st Workshop on Flexible Advanced Information Systems (FAiSE'2018) held in conjunction with CAiSE'2018, Tallinn, Estonia, 2018.
[10]
H. Green. The Internet of Things in the Cognitive Era: Realizing the Future and Full Potential of Connected Devices. www-01.ibm.com/common/ssi/cgi-bin/ssialias?htmlfid=WWW12366USEN, December 2015.
[11]
P. Grefen, N. Brouns, L. Ludwig, and E. Serral. Co-location Specification for IoT-Aware Collaborative Business Processes. In Proceedings of CAiSE'2019 Forum held in conjunction with the 31st International Conference on Advanced Information Systems Engineering (CAiSE'2019), Rome, Italy, 2019.
[12]
F. Hasić and E. Serral Asensio. Executing IoT Processes in BPMN 2.0: Current Support and Remaining Challenges. In Proceedings of the IEEE 13th International Conference on Research Challenges in Information Science (RCIS'2019), Brussels, Belgium, May 2019.
[13]
Z. Maamar, T. Baker, N. Faci, E. Ugljanin, Y. Atif, M. Al-Khafajiy, and M. Sellami. Cognitive Computing Meets the Internet of Things. In Proceedings of the 13th International Conference on Software Technologies (ICSOFT'2018), Porto, Portugal, 2018.
[14]
Z. Maamar, T. Baker, M. Sellami, M. Asim, E. Ugljanin, and N. Faci. Cloud versus Edge: Who Serves the Internet-of-Things Better? Internet Technology Letters, Wiley, 1(5), June 2018.
[15]
Z. Maamar, K. Boukadi, E. Ugljanin, T. Baker, M. Asim, M. Al-Khafajiy, D. Benslimane, and H. El Alaoui El Abdallaoui. Thing Federation as a Service: Foundations and Demonstration. In Proceedings of the 8th International Conference on Model and Data Engineering (MEDI'2018), Marrakesh, Morocco, 2018.
[16]
Z. Maamar, M. Sellami, N. Faci, E. Ugljanin, and Q. Sheng. Storytelling Integration of the Internet of Things into Business Processes. In Proceedings of the Business Process Management Forum (BPM Forum'2018) held in conjunction with the 16th International Conference on Business Process Management (BPM'2018), Sydney, NSW, Australia, 2018.
[17]
S. Mandal, M. Hewelt, M. Oestreich, and M. Weske. A Classification Framework for IoT Scenarios. In Proceedings of the 2nd International Workshop on BP-Meet-IoT held conjunction with BPM'2018, Sydney, Australia, September 2018.
[18]
D. Marlon, L. R. Marcello, M. Jan, and H. Reijers. Fundamentals of Business Process Management. Springer, 2013.
[19]
F. Martins and D. Domingos. Modelling IoT Behaviour within BPMN Business Processes. In Proceedings of the International Conference on ENTERprise Information Systems (CENTERIS'2017), Barcelona, Spain, 2017.
[20]
G. Meroni. Integrating the Internet of Things with Business Process Management: A Process-aware Framework for Smart Objects. In Proceedings of CAiSE'2015 Doctoral Consortium at the 27th International Conference on Advanced Information Systems Engineering (CAiSE'2015), Stockholm, Sweden, 2015. Springer Link.
[21]
S. Meyer, A. Ruppen, and C. Magerkurth. Internet of Things-Aware Process Modeling: Integrating IoT Devices as Business Process Resources. In Proceedings of the International Conference on Advanced Information Systems Engineering (CAiSE'2013), Valencia, Spain, 2013.
[22]
D. Mukherjee, D. Pal, and P. Misra. Workflow for the Internet of Thing. In Proceedings of the 19th International Conference on Enterprise Information Systems (ICEIS'2017), Porto, Portugal, 2017.
[23]
A. Qamar, A. Muhammad, Z. Maamar, T. Baker, and S. Saeed. A Quality-of-Things Model for Assessing the Internet-of-Thing's Non-Functional Properties. Transactions on Emerging Telecommunications Technologies, 2019 (forthcoming).
[24]
M. Razzaque, M. Milojevic-Jevric, A. Palade, and S. Clarke. Middleware for Internet of Things: A Survey. IEEE Internet of Things Journal, 3(1), 2016.
[25]
S. Schönig, L. Ackermann, and S. Jablonski. Internet of Things Meets BPM: A Conceptual Integration Framework. In Proceedings of the 8th International Conference on Simulation and Modeling Methodologies, Technologies and Applications (SIMULTECH'2018), Porto, Portugal, 2018.
[26]
S. Schönig, L. Ackermann, S. Jablonski, and A. Ermer. An Integrated Architecture for IoT-Aware Business Process Execution. In Proceedings of the 19th Edition of Business Process Modeling, Design and Support Conference (BPMDS'2018) held in conjunction with CAiSE'2018, Tallinn, Estonia, 2018.
[27]
R. Seiger, M. Gohlke, and U. Aßmann. Augmented Reality-Based Process Modelling for the Internet of Things with HoloFlows. In Proceedings of the 20th International Conference on Enterprise, Business-Process and Information Systems Modeling (BPMDS'2019) held in conjunction with CAiSE'2019, Rome, Italy, 2019.
[28]
R. Seiger, P. Heisig, and U. Aßmann. Retrofitting of Workflow Management Systems with Self-X Capabilities for Internet of Things. In Proceedings of the 2nd International Workshop on BP-Meet-IoT held conjunction with BPM'2018, Sydney, Australia, September 2018.
[29]
Z. Sheng, C. Mahapatra, C. Zhu, and V. Leung. Recent Advances in Industrial Wireless Sensor Networks Toward Efficient Management in IoT. IEEE Access, 3, 2015.
[30]
K. Suri, W. Gaaloul, A. Cuccuru, and S. Gerard. Semantic Framework for Internet of Things-Aware Business Process Development. In Proceedings of the 26th IEEE International Conference on Enabling Technologies: Infrastructure for Collaborative Enterprises (WETICE'2017), Poznan, Poland, 2017.
[31]
P. Vlacheas, R. Giaffreda, V. Stavroulaki, D. Kelaidonis, V. Foteinos, G. Poulios, P. Demestichas, A. Somov, A. Biswas, and K. Moessner. Enabling Smart Cities through a Cognitive Management Framework for the Internet of Things. IEEE Communications Magazine, 51(6), 2013.
[32]
S. Ware, R. Young, B. Harrison, and D. Roberts. A computational model of narrative conflict at the fabula level. IEEE Transactions on Computational Intelligence and Artificial Intelligence in Games, 6(3), 2014.
[33]
M. Weiser. The Computer for the 21st Century. Newsletter ACM SIGMOBILE Mobile Computing and Communications Review, 3(3), 199.
[34]
M. Weske. Business Process Management - Concepts, Languages, Architectures. 2nd Edition, Springer, 2012.
[35]
Q. Wu, G. Ding, Y. Xu, S. Feg, Z. Du, J. Wang, and K. Long. Cognitive Internet of Things: A New Paradigm Beyond Connection. IEEE Internet of Things Journal, 1(2), April 2014.
[36]
F. Zambonelli. Key Abstractions for IoT-Oriented Software Engineering. IEEE Software, 34(1), January-February 2017.

Cited By

View all
  • (2024)On the Interplay Between Business Process Management and Internet-of-ThingsBusiness & Information Systems Engineering10.1007/s12599-024-00859-6Online publication date: 18-Mar-2024
  • (2024)A BPMN-Based Approach for IoT Systems EngineeringFluidware10.1007/978-3-031-62146-8_5(85-105)Online publication date: 13-May-2024
  • (2023)Smart-IoT Business Process Management: A Case Study on Remote Digital Early Cardiac Arrhythmia Detection and DiagnosisIEEE Internet of Things Journal10.1109/JIOT.2023.326982010:19(16744-16757)Online publication date: 1-Oct-2023
  • Show More Cited By

Recommendations

Comments

Information & Contributors

Information

Published In

cover image ACM Other conferences
IDEAS '20: Proceedings of the 24th Symposium on International Database Engineering & Applications
August 2020
252 pages
ISBN:9781450375030
DOI:10.1145/3410566
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 25 August 2020

Permissions

Request permissions for this article.

Check for updates

Author Tags

  1. business process
  2. collaboration
  3. context
  4. internet of things

Qualifiers

  • Research-article

Conference

IDEAS 2020

Acceptance Rates

IDEAS '20 Paper Acceptance Rate 27 of 57 submissions, 47%;
Overall Acceptance Rate 74 of 210 submissions, 35%

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• Downloads (Last 12 months)23
  • Downloads (Last 6 weeks)2
Reflects downloads up to 08 Mar 2025

Other Metrics

Citations

Cited By

View all
  • (2024)On the Interplay Between Business Process Management and Internet-of-ThingsBusiness & Information Systems Engineering10.1007/s12599-024-00859-6Online publication date: 18-Mar-2024
  • (2024)A BPMN-Based Approach for IoT Systems EngineeringFluidware10.1007/978-3-031-62146-8_5(85-105)Online publication date: 13-May-2024
  • (2023)Smart-IoT Business Process Management: A Case Study on Remote Digital Early Cardiac Arrhythmia Detection and DiagnosisIEEE Internet of Things Journal10.1109/JIOT.2023.326982010:19(16744-16757)Online publication date: 1-Oct-2023
  • (2023)A multi-type artifact framework for cyber–physical, social systems design and developmentInternet of Things10.1016/j.iot.2023.10082022(100820)Online publication date: Jul-2023
  • (2022)A systematic literature review on IoT-aware business process modeling views, requirements and notationsSoftware and Systems Modeling10.1007/s10270-022-01049-222:3(969-1004)Online publication date: 28-Oct-2022

View Options

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Figures

Tables

Media

Share

Share

Share this Publication link

Share on social media